Jane Austen is the world's bestselling novelist. Two hundred years after her death we seem to have a never-ending appetite for the swooning of Sense and Sensibility and the smoldering passion of Pride and Prejudice, resulting in a near constant supply of film adaptations and spin-off books. The fan market for Austen--the Austenites--is huge and international. This book, previously published as The Jane Austen Miscellany and republished in an attractive new gift edition, reveals the real Jane: bitchy, gossipy and badly behaved at times, as well as showing the side we all love: the writer, sister and true romantic.
